We shall start our journey at Yishum Dam. Yishun Dam – a.k.a. Seletar Dam – separates the freshwater of Lower Seletar Reservoir from the saltwater in the Johore Strait – you know, as dams do. But that doesn’t stop it from being a popular destination for romantic getaways, especially during sunset.
Next, we will explore the areas around the Jenal Jetty, the last fishing village in Singapore! Just so you know, Jenal Jetty is private property so we won't be going into the Jetty itself. But we shall explore the beach areas where we can catch a nice view of the Jetty from afar.
Finally, we continue our walk into two islands - Pulau Punggol Barat and Pulau Punggol Timor as we head onward towards Punggol.
